Oracle学习(一)

1:Oracel 不区分大小写

2:对于数值类型的字段,可以进行相应的四目运算

3:别名 as ,如果含有特殊字符串,加引号

4:连接列的值,用 ||

5:处理NULL ,用NVL()    NVL(字段,值1),如果一段的值是NULL,则返回值1,也可以升级为NVL(表达式1,表达式2)

6:order by  如果select *的话 可以用 1 2 3 (列号)来order by

字符型函数

 

1LOWER 转小写  

 

 

2UPPER

3INITCAP 首字母大写  

4CONCAT 连接字符,相当于 ||  

5SUBSTR SUBSTR(column|expression , m  ,[,n])  取得字符串中指定起始位置和长度的字符串

6LENGTH  返回字符串的长度  

7NVL  转换空值

数学运算函数 

1ROUND  

  四舍五入:ROUND(45.9232) = 45.92  

  ROUND(45.9230) = 46  

  ROUND(45.923-1) = 50

 

2TRUNC  

 

  截取函数  

 

  TRUNC(45.9232)= 45.92  

 

  TRUNC(45.923)= 45  

 

  TRUNC(45.923-1)= 40

 

3MOD 余除  

 

  MOD(1600300)

 日期格式和日期型函数

 

 

1、默认格式为DD-MON-YY.  

2SYSDATE是一个求系统时间的函数  

3DUAL是一个伪表,有人称之为空表,但不确切。SELECT SYSDATE FROM SYS.DUAL 选出系统时间  

表连接

http://blog.csdn.net/spark998/article/details/2065269

  

posted @ 2016-09-08 16:50  情难舍,人难留  阅读(205)  评论(0编辑  收藏  举报